Hurricane Helene power outages leave millions in the dark—poorer areas often wait longest for electricity to be restored

Hurricane Helene cut power to more than 4 million homes and businesses as it moved across the Southeast after hitting Florida’s Big Bend region as a powerful Category 4 storm on Sept. 26, 2024. As Helene’s rains moved into the mountains, causing devastating flooding, officials warned that fixing downed utility lines and restoring power would take several days.
